About Pat Garcia Veterans Memorial Park in Wichita
Pat Garcia Veterans Memorial Park in Wichita, Kansas, is a serene and respectful site dedicated to honoring the legacy and sacrifices of war veteran Pat Garcia. This 1.6-acre park was developed through a collaboration between the City of Wichita, the North Chisholm Neighborhood Association, and Friends of Pat Garcia. The park pays tribute to Pat Garcia's memory while providing a space for community engagement and fitness.
One of the park's most notable features is the state-of-the-art outdoor Fitness Court, designed through a partnership among the National Fitness Campaign, Blue Cross Blue Shield of Kansas, and Wichita Park and Recreation. This facility includes seven exercise stations that allow users to perform bodyweight-based workouts, accommodating people aged 14 and up and all fitness levels. The Fitness Court App enhances the experience by offering guided workout routines. Opened on May 10, 2024, it represents the park's commitment to fostering physical health in the community while creating a shared space that symbolizes honor and unity.
The park's focus is not only on fitness but also on commemoration. As a memorial park, it embodies a peaceful environment where visitors can reflect and appreciate the contributions of veterans. Although primarily a memorial and fitness-focused space, the park also welcomes visitors seeking a tranquil spot for relaxation and leisure.
